Unveiling the Developer's World: A Beginner's Look at Software Programming

The world of software development can seem like a mysterious realm filled with complex jargon and intricate code. But beneath the surface lies a fascinating and rewarding field that empowers individuals to design innovative solutions and bring their ideas to life. For aspiring developers, the journey often begins with a fundamental grasp of programming languages and concepts. These languages serve as the building blocks for software, allowing developers to direct computers in performing specific tasks. Learning to code is akin to learning a new language, requiring patience, persistence, and a willingness to discover.

There are numerous programming languages available, each with its own strengths and applications. Some popular choices for beginners include Python, known for its clarity, and JavaScript, essential for web development. As you delve deeper into the world of coding, you'll encounter various software development methodologies, such as Agile and Waterfall, which provide frameworks for organizing and managing projects.

The beauty web design of programming lies in its flexibility. Developers can apply their skills to a wide range of domains, from creating interactive websites and mobile applications to developing complex algorithms and artificial intelligence systems. Whether your passion lies in gaming, data science, or cybersecurity, there's a place for you in the ever-evolving world of software development.
